#41e694 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#41e694 is composed of 25.5% red, 90.2% green and 58%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 71.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 35.7% yellow and 9.8% black. It has a hue angle of 150.2 degrees, a saturation of 76.7% and a lightness of 57.8%. #41e694 color hex could be obtained by blending #82ffff with #00cd29. Closest websafe color is: #33ff99.

#41e694 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#41e694 has RGB values of R:65, G:230, B:148 and CMYK values of C:0.72, M:0, Y:0.36, K:0.1. Its decimal value is 4318868.
